The Breakdown 23

  • Award-winning actor Mark Ruffalo has taken a bold stance against Paramount Pictures, criticizing the company’s proposed $110 billion merger with Warner Bros. Discovery while linking it to the ongoing Israel-Gaza conflict and accusing key figures of supporting "genocide."
  • In response, Paramount has accused Ruffalo of antisemitism, stating that his comments invoke harmful stereotypes and prejudice, igniting a heated back-and-forth between the actor and the studio.
  • Ruffalo vehemently rejects the allegations, calling them "appalling" and "fundamentally dishonest," while asserting that his critiques are not directed at Jewish people but at corporate complicity in global violence.
  • The conflict underscores a significant cultural moment in Hollywood, where artistic expression meets corporate accountability, illustrating Ruffalo's role as a social activist willing to confront tough geopolitical issues.
  • As the media frenzy around this feud continues, both sides express their commitment to their perspectives, highlighting a pivotal discourse on the intersection of entertainment, activism, and social responsibility.
  • This story reveals the complexities within public discussions surrounding Israel and antisemitism, positioning Ruffalo’s activism against a backdrop of corporate power and moral responsibility.

What are the details of the Paramount merger?

The Paramount merger refers to the proposed $111 billion acquisition of Warner Bros. Discovery by Paramount Skydance. This deal has garnered attention due to concerns about the influence of technology firms like Oracle, particularly regarding their ties to the Israeli military and the ongoing Israel-Gaza conflict. Mark Ruffalo has been vocal in opposing the merger, arguing that it could lead to unethical practices and complicity in violence against Palestinians.

Who are Larry and David Ellison?

Larry Ellison is the co-founder of Oracle Corporation, a major technology company known for its database software and cloud solutions. His son, David Ellison, is a film producer and executive involved with Skydance Media, which is part of the Paramount merger. Both have faced criticism from Mark Ruffalo for their perceived connections to the Israeli military through Oracle's technology, which Ruffalo claims contributes to human rights violations.

What accusations did Ruffalo face?

Mark Ruffalo faced accusations of antisemitism after he criticized the Paramount-Warner Bros. merger, linking Oracle's technology to the Israeli military's actions in Gaza. Paramount and other critics claimed that Ruffalo's comments invoked antisemitic tropes, suggesting that his opposition to the merger was rooted in hostility toward Jewish people. Ruffalo has vehemently denied these accusations, asserting that his views are not anti-Jewish but rather a critique of corporate complicity in violence.

What is Oracle's role in this controversy?

Oracle, under the leadership of Larry Ellison, plays a central role in the controversy surrounding the Paramount merger. The company has been implicated in providing technology to the Israeli military, which has raised concerns among activists like Mark Ruffalo. Ruffalo argues that the merger could facilitate further involvement of Oracle in military actions, thereby contributing to what he describes as 'genocide' against Palestinians. This connection has made Oracle a focal point in discussions about ethics in corporate mergers.

How does this relate to the Israel-Gaza conflict?

The controversy surrounding the Paramount merger is deeply intertwined with the Israel-Gaza conflict, particularly regarding Oracle's alleged support of Israeli military operations. Ruffalo's criticisms highlight the ethical implications of corporate involvement in geopolitical issues, especially when technology is used in warfare. His statements about 'genocide' refer to the humanitarian crisis in Gaza, drawing attention to the broader impact of corporate actions on global conflicts and human rights.

What are antisemitism tropes in media?

Antisemitism tropes in media refer to stereotypical and harmful portrayals of Jewish individuals or communities that perpetuate prejudice and discrimination. Common tropes include portraying Jews as greedy, manipulative, or overly influential in politics and finance. In the context of the Ruffalo-Paramount dispute, critics accused Ruffalo of invoking such tropes when he linked corporate actions to broader geopolitical conflicts. The discussion around these tropes emphasizes the importance of sensitivity in public discourse, especially regarding ethnic and religious identities.

What historical context surrounds Hollywood mergers?

Hollywood mergers have a long history, often driven by the need for companies to consolidate resources, expand market reach, and adapt to changing consumer behaviors. Major mergers, such as Disney's acquisition of Pixar and Fox, have reshaped the industry landscape. These consolidations can lead to increased power for fewer companies, raising concerns about diversity in storytelling and corporate influence over cultural narratives. The current Paramount-Warner Bros. merger reflects ongoing trends of consolidation amidst debates about ethical practices and corporate responsibility.
